Summary
This study aims to understand how a type of white blood cell called eosinophils contributes to DRESS syndrome, a severe and potentially life-threatening drug allergy. Researchers will compare blood and skin samples from 80 adults with DRESS, other drug rashes, and healthy volunteers. The goal is to find better ways to diagnose and treat this condition in the future.
